Knowledge Marine Shares to Split in a 1:5 Ratio

The first company making waves is Knowledge Marine, which formally informed stock exchanges that its shares will undergo a split reducing the face value from ₹5 to ₹1 per share, effectively dividing each existing stock into five parts. While the company has yet to announce an official record date for the corporate action, it follows a previous stock split executed in 2025 where shares were divided into two tranches. Closing its latest trading session on Friday at ₹2,731.50 with a modest 1 percent gain, Knowledge Marine boasts an extraordinary long-term track record. Over the past year, the share price has surged by 228 percent, delivered a 396 percent return over two years, and achieved an astronomical 11,281 percent growth over a five-year period.

Gujarat Natural Announces Massive 1:10 Stock Split

The second major announcement comes from Gujarat Natural, which revealed plans for a substantial stock split dividing its shares into ten parts. According to regulatory filings submitted to the stock exchanges, the company's face value will drop from ₹10 down to ₹1 per share. Closing down over 2 percent on Friday at ₹111.41 on the BSE, Gujarat Natural has nevertheless maintained a stellar multi-year growth profile. The stock has delivered a 58 percent gain over the past year, an impressive 850 percent return over two years, a 904 percent increase over three years, and a staggering 1,047 percent surge over five years. Historical data indicates that the company last distributed a dividend of ₹0.10 per share back in 2017, while public shareholding data shows promoters holding a 1.93 percent stake as of the June quarter, down slightly from 2.31 percent in the preceding March quarter.
